Another trick that I've found, if you have your picture on a mobile device, is to email it to yourself. My phone then asks me what size I want to send it and I click small. Then when I get the email, I simply re-save it to my photo gallery to upload here.

Another option is to size your photos in your phone settings.  I know in my phone, I can set the size of the pictures I will be taking in the settings and then I don't have to worry about sizing the actual photos down later. 

The only problem with that is if you want to crop something out of the smaller photo later, you could end up with a really small image.
